France’s Ingenico Group has bolstered its position in Southeast Asia by signing a deal to acquire Singapore-based Nera Payment Solutions, the payment solutions business of Nera Telecommunications, for SGD88m ($63.8m).
Nera Payment, a developer of payment software, has presence in Thailand, Singapore, Indonesia, the Philippines, Malaysia and Vietnam.
It generates SGD47m in revenue a year and has a workforce of over 250.
Following the deal, Ingenico Group’s will be able to leverage Nera’s existing distribution and services network – call centers and field services.
The deal is expected to complete during the third quarter of 2016.
Ingenico Group EVP for Asia Pacific & Middle East Patrice Le Marre said: "I’m pleased that the Nera Payment Solutions management team is joining Ingenico Group. Nera Payment Solutions is in a good position to double its revenue in the coming years. With this strategic acquisition, we will be able to fully capture Asia’s strong market growth."
